  H.R. No. 1932
 
 
 
R E S O L U T I O N
 
         WHEREAS, During the 84th Texas Legislature, Miranda Heck has
  ably served her fellow Texans in the office of State Representative
  Jason Isaac through the Texas A&M University Public Policy
  Internship Program; and
         WHEREAS, The program offers a unique opportunity for current
  A&M students to serve as interns in the Texas Legislature, allowing
  participants to gain a better understanding of the legislative
  process as well as their individual strengths and professional
  goals; and
         WHEREAS, Ms. Heck is a senior at A&M, working toward her
  bachelor of arts in telecommunications and a minor in English; she
  has taken part in the school's Big Event, and she gives freely of
  her time and talents as a summer volunteer for the Emporium of the
  Arts in Woodville; committed to her faith, she is active in the Hope
  Groups at Living Hope Baptist Church in College Station and with the
  TAMU Campus Crusade for Christ; and
         WHEREAS, This outstanding young Texan has performed her
  duties as a legislative intern with skill and dedication, and she is
  indeed deserving of special recognition for her fine work; now,
  therefore, be it
         RESOLVED, That the House of Representatives of the 84th Texas
  Legislature hereby commend Miranda Heck for her service in the
  office of State Representative Jason Isaac as a participant in the
  Texas A&M University Public Policy Internship Program and extend to
  her sincere best wishes for continued success in all her future
  endeavors; and, be it further
         RESOLVED, That an official copy of this resolution be
  prepared for Ms. Heck as an expression of high regard by the Texas
  House of Representatives.
